How Much Does It Cost to Rent a Sprinter Van in Clovis, California?

Clovis sprinter van rental prices generally range from around $200–$340 per hour depending on the vehicle size, the date, and how long you need it. A standard 10- to 12-passenger sprinter van for a weekday airport run or corporate shuttle typically lands on the lower end of that range. A larger 18- to 20-passenger build on a Saturday night during wedding season or prom will run closer to the top.

Trip Duration, Hourly Rates, and Total Hours Shape Your Clovis Sprinter Van Price

Most Clovis sprinter van rentals are priced on an hourly basis, and the clock typically runs from the moment the vehicle leaves for pickup to the moment it returns after drop-off — not just the time your group is actively riding. A two-hour wedding shuttle between Clovis hotels and a venue on Herndon Avenue is a different billing situation than a six-hour night-out run with multiple stops and a late return. Standby time — when the vehicle waits while your group is inside a venue — counts toward your total.

Date, Season, and Day of the Week Move Clovis Sprinter Van Prices Significantly

Timing matters a lot for Clovis sprinter van rental pricing. Friday and Saturday evenings command weekend premiums year-round — demand from weddings, birthday parties, and night-out groups is consistently higher on those nights. Wedding season in the Central Valley runs hard from late April through October, and prom season (typically April through May across Clovis Unified and surrounding districts) creates a concentrated spike in demand that pushes both prices and availability tight fast.

Summer weekends near Clovis are particularly busy for wine country runs up to the Sierra foothills. Booking a Clovis sprinter van rental at least two to three months out for any Saturday event between May and September is strongly advised — waiting until the last few weeks almost always means higher rates or limited vehicle selection.

Distance, Mileage, and Route Complexity Affect Your Clovis Sprinter Van Rate

Where your group is going from Clovis matters beyond just the hours on the clock. Longer routes — say, a round trip from Clovis to Yosemite Valley, which the National Park Service lists at about 2.5 hours from Fresno Yosemite International Airport to Yosemite Valley — add mileage and mountain-road time that factors into the overall price depending on the operator's rate structure. Routes that cross mountain grades on Highway 168 toward Huntington Lake or require navigation through Fresno's downtown grid during peak hours add complexity compared to a flat, direct run on Shaw Avenue or Herndon; Caltrans posts current SR 168 conditions and provides road information at 1-800-427-7623, which helps your group avoid building a mountain itinerary around an active closure or traffic control.

If your itinerary includes multiple pickup addresses across Clovis and Fresno, or requires the vehicle to deadhead back to a staging area between runs, those details belong in your quote request — they directly affect what you'll pay.

Is there a typical booking length required for a Clovis sprinter van rental?

Most Clovis sprinter van rentals have a typical booking window — commonly two to four hours depending on the vehicle type, the operator, and the day of the week. Weekend and evening bookings tend to carry higher windows than weekday transfers. When you submit your quote request, the options returned will reflect what's available for your specific timeframe.

Does the price change if I add more stops to my Clovis itinerary?

Yes — additional stops extend the total time the vehicle is in service, which adds to the overall booked hours. A multi-stop bachelorette run through Old Town Clovis and the Tower District costs more than a direct point-to-point transfer because the vehicle is active longer. Build every planned stop into your quote request upfront so the pricing reflects your actual itinerary.

Why are Saturday sprinter van rentals in Clovis more expensive than weekday trips?

Saturday is simply the busiest rental day of the week — weddings, birthday parties, bachelorette runs, and night-out groups all compete for the same vehicles on Friday and Saturday evenings. Higher demand with fixed supply pushes rates up. If your event has flexibility, a Thursday or Sunday booking in the same vehicle can sometimes come in noticeably lower than a Saturday night equivalent.

How far in advance should I book a sprinter van rental in Clovis?

For Saturday events during wedding season (May through October) or prom season (April through May), booking two to three months out is the smart move — that window books fast across the Fresno metro. For weekday corporate shuttles or off-peak trips, two to four weeks of lead time is generally workable. The earlier you lock in a date, the better your vehicle selection and pricing.

Will I pay more if the sprinter van has to travel a long distance to reach Clovis for pickup?

Possibly. If the nearest available vehicle for your date is staged outside Clovis, deadhead mileage — the distance the vehicle travels to reach your pickup point — can factor into the total cost depending on the operator's rate structure. Giving accurate pickup and drop-off addresses in your quote request helps avoid surprises and matches you to the closest available option.

What happens if my event runs late and I need the sprinter van longer than originally booked?

If your event runs over the original booking window, additional time is typically billed in increments — commonly per hour or per half-hour — at the operator's applicable overtime rate. The best way to avoid unexpected charges is to build a realistic buffer into your original booking. If you know your event historically runs long, booking one extra hour upfront is usually cleaner than extending on the spot.
